Course Description

Join noted QuickBooks Point of Sale expert Will English as he provides an overview of the new QuickBooks Desktop Point of Sale Desktop 18.0. Learn how your clients can quickly ring up sales, process credit cards, track inventory and be prepared for tax time with this all-in-one retail solution! Course Objectives:


  • Intro to QuickBooks Desktop Point of Sale 18.0

  • When are your clients a good fit for QuickBooks Desktop Point of Sale?

  • Ring up sales faster – Dive into common workflows and reports in QuickBooks Desktop Point of Sale, and learn how to save time using Intuit Payments

  • QuickBooks Desktop integration – Learn how to keep financials updated by synching daily sales into QuickBooks Desktop Financial

  • Let’s get started! Learn how to set your clients up with QuickBooks Desktop Point of Sale

Mr. English has over twenty years of experience in helping small businesses and non-profits manage their finances. He holds a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ration with an Accountancy focus from National University in San Diego, C.A. A two-time small business owner, Mr. English, is an award-winning Certified Intuit Premier Reseller (IPR) and an Advanced Certified ProAdvisor in both QuickBooks Financial and Point of Sale (POS) software, assisting clients nationwide including Hawaii. His extensive background in working with QuickBooks POS started at version 2. He has been using and supporting QuickBooks for over 15 years starting with the first DOS version of QuickBooks where he was hired by Intuit, the makers of QuickBooks, as one of the first accounting trained technical support representatives for the program. Mr. English is an active tester in the QuickBooks beta program where he performs software testing. He is a national recognized trainer for both the Sleeter Group and the Joe Woodard Scaling New Heights conference as well as a co-author of two versions of the QuickBooks POS store operations handbooks. The EM$ website provides technical and marketing information to QuickBooks ProAdvisors all over the country. Mr. English was named one of the 2014-17 Top 100 ProAdvisors by Intuitive Accountant, receiving national recognition as a leading consultant who has embraced the Intuit ProAdvisor program and leveraged it to better serve clients and grow our business.

We started small in 1983 with Quicken personal finance software, simplifying a common household dilemma: balancing the family checkbook. Today, we've improved the lives of more than 45 million people, and our annual revenue exceeds $4 billion. We're publicly traded with the symbol INTU on the Nasdaq Stock Market, and regularly recognized as one of the best places to work in locations around the world.
